TARIFF FOR GAS SERVICE TXU GAS COMPANY <br /> <br /> RATE SCHEDULE: 10 I Rate T - Transportation <br /> APPLICABLE TO: I Entire System REVISION: 0 <br /> DATE: <br /> <br />EFFECTIVE DATE: PAGE: 2 OF 3 <br />Monthly Imbalance Fees <br /> <br />Customer shall pay Company the greater of (i) $0.10 per MMBtu, or (ii) 150% of the difference per MMBtu <br />between the highest and lowest "midpoint" price for the Katy point listed in Platts Gas Daily in the table <br />entitled "Daily Price Survey" during such month, for the MMBtu of Customer's monthly Cumulative <br />Imbalance, as defined in the applicable Transportation Agreement, at the end of each month that exceeds <br />10% of Customer's receipt quantities for the month. <br /> <br />Daily Imbalance Fees <br /> <br />Company may, upon prior written notice, begin billing Customer for Excess Daily imbalance Quantities <br />during each month. "Excess Daily Imbalance Quantities" means the portion of Customer's daily <br />imbalance that exceeds 10% of Customer's receipt quantities for such Gas Day. Customer shall pay <br />Company for each MMBtu of any Excess Daily Imbalance Quantities incurred during a month at the <br />greater of: (i) $0.10 per MMBtu, or (ii) 150% of the difference between the highest and the lowest <br />"midpoint" price for the Katy point listed in Platts Gas Daily in the table entitled "Daily Price Surve~/' during <br />such month. <br /> <br /> Hourly Imbalance Fees <br /> <br /> For a Customer whose maximum daily quantity established in the applicable Transportation Agreement is <br /> 10,000 MMBtu or greater, Company will bill such Customer each month for Excess Hourly Imbalance <br /> Quantities. "Excess Hourly imbalance Quantities" means that portion of the difference between the <br /> quantity delivered to Customer during any hour, and the average hourly confirmed Receipt Nomination for <br /> such Gas Day, which exceeds 10% of such average confirmed Receipt Nomination. Customer shall pay <br /> Company for each MMBtu of any Excess Hourly Imbalance Quant[ties incurred during a month a fee of <br /> $0.50 per MMBtu. <br /> <br /> Operational Flow Order Imbalance Fee <br /> <br /> In the event Company has notified Customer that an Operational Flow Order (OFO) is in place, Customer <br /> shall pay Company a fee on Excess Hourly OFO Imbalance Quantities during any Operational Flow Order <br /> event. "Excess Hourly OFO Imbalance Quantities" means: <br /> <br /> (a) In the event Company notifies Customer that receipt point quantities should be equal to or <br /> greater than delivery point quantities, Excess Hourly OFO Imbalance Quantities is that portion of <br /> the positive difference between (i) the quantities delivered to Customer during any hour, less <br /> the average hourly confirmed Receipt Nomination for such Gas Day, which exceeds 10% of such <br /> confirmed Receipt Nomination; or <br /> <br /> (b) In the event Company notifies Customer that receipt point quantities should be less than <br /> or equal to delivery point quantities, Excess Hourly OFO Imbalance Quantities is that portion of <br /> the positive difference between (i) the average hourly confirmed Receipt Nomination for the <br /> applicable Gas Day, less (ii) the quantities delivered to Customer during any hour of such Gas <br /> Day, which exceeds 10% of such Receipt Nomination. <br /> Customer shall pay Company for each MMBtu of any Excess Hourly OFO Imbalance Quantities incurred <br /> during a month at 150% of the highest ~common" price for the Katy point listed in Platts Gas Daily in the <br /> table entitled "Daily Price Survey" during the time the Operational Flow Order is in place. <br /> <br /> -23- <br /> <br /> <br />
